Recipe preparation for One pot chicken risoni with crispy salami

How to Make One Pot Chicken Risoni with Crispy Salami

Sauté the Salami: Start by heating olive oil in a large pot over medium heat. Add sliced salami and cook until crispy, about 3-4 minutes. The aroma will make you want to dive right in!

Cook the Chicken: Add boneless chicken thighs to the pot with salt and pepper. Sauté until browned on both sides, approximately 5-6 minutes. Watch for lovely golden-brown edges—this adds flavor!

Add Garlic and Risoni: Toss in minced garlic and risoni pasta next. Stir everything together until fragrant, about 1 minute. The garlic should become aromatic but not burnt—keep an eye on it!

Pour in Broth: Carefully pour in chicken broth while scraping any bits stuck to the bottom of the pot. Bring to a simmer over medium-high heat; this will help develop deep flavors.

Cook Until Tender: Reduce heat to low, cover, and let it cook for 10-12 minutes until risoni is tender and absorbs most of the liquid. Stir occasionally to prevent sticking—like giving your dinner a gentle hug!

Add Fresh Herbs: Finally, stir in chopped fresh herbs before serving to brighten up those rich flavors! Taste once more; adjust seasoning if needed. Your masterpiece is ready to shine!

Storing & Reheating

Store leftovers in an airtight container in the fridge for up to three days. Reheat gently on the stove with a splash of broth to maintain moisture.

One Pot Chicken Risoni with Crispy Salami

One Pot Chicken Risoni with Crispy Salami is a delightful and comforting dish that brings together tender chicken, savory salami, and quick-cooking risoni in a single pot. This recipe is perfect for busy weeknights or special gatherings, offering an explosion of flavors and aromas that will leave everyone wanting more. With minimal cleanup required, it’s as convenient as it is delicious!

  • Author: Jennifer
  • Prep Time: 10 minutes
  • Cook Time: 20 minutes
  • Total Time: 30 minutes
  • Yield: Serves 4
  • Category: Main
  • Method: Sautéing
  • Cuisine: Italian

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 lb boneless, skinless chicken thighs
  • 1 cup risoni pasta
  • 4 oz crispy salami, sliced
  • 3 cloves fresh garlic, minced
  • 4 cups chicken broth
  • 1/4 cup fresh parsley or basil, chopped
  • 2 tbsp olive oil
  • Salt and pepper to taste

Instructions

  1. Heat olive oil in a large pot over medium heat. Add sliced salami and cook until crispy (3-4 minutes).
  2. Add chicken thighs, season with salt and pepper, and brown on both sides (5-6 minutes).
  3. Stir in minced garlic and risoni; cook until fragrant (about 1 minute).
  4. Pour in chicken broth and bring to a simmer, scraping the pot’s bottom for flavor.
  5. Reduce heat to low, cover, and cook for 10-12 minutes until risoni is tender and most liquid is absorbed.
  6. Stir in fresh herbs before serving. Adjust seasoning if needed.
